Definitions
In this subchapter:
Antitrust laws
The term “antitrust laws”—
has the meaning given the term in section 12 of title 15;
includes section 45 of title 15 to the extent that section 45 of title 15 applies to unfair methods of competition; and
includes any State antitrust law, but only to the extent that such law is consistent with the law referred to in subparagraph (A) or the law referred to in subparagraph (B).
Appropriate Federal entities
The term “appropriate Federal entities” means the following:
The Department of Commerce.
The Department of Defense.
The Department of Energy.
The Department of Homeland Security.
The Department of Justice.
The Department of the Treasury.
The Office of the Director of National Intelligence.
